On January 13, Nebraska’s largest daily paper, the Omaha World-Herald, posted a story headlined, “Officials say they’ve dismantled large Mexican meth ring in Omaha area.”
The story said 20 people affiliated with Mexico’s dangerous, large Sinaloa drug cartel had been arrested, with at least 12 more warrants outstanding.
Lest anyone wonder about a powerful Latino mob operating in the U.S. heartland, the story quoted Omaha Police Chief Todd Schmaderer:
“The impact a cartel from Mexico may have on Omaha is much more than anyone thinks. We made a dent in this particular connection; now the task is to see what other connections are out there and to go after them.”
A few days later the World-Herald ran an article on a different topic headlined, “Nebraska schools challenged to meet needs of growing minority.”
The story, posted January 18, said, “As racial minorities take up more seats in the classroom, schools will be challenged to meet the needs of this growing group. Schools are likely to come under increasing political pressure to erase stubborn achievement gaps, overcome language barriers, and educate groups of students who are historically poorer than whites.”
As accompanying graphic said that for the 2014-2015 school year, 68.2 percent of Nebraska students are white, 6.7 percent are black, 2.4 percent are Asian, while 17.7 are Hispanic. The other 5 percent, such as Native Americans, wasn’t delineated.
“Minorities as a whole are steadily gaining in the state, led by Hispanic, Asian, and mixed-race students,” the story said.

Earlier in the month, the official voice of the newspaper, a World-Herald editorial, was headlined, “Work together to tackle poverty problem.”
Reporting that “Nebraska was one of only seven states to see an increase in its number of undocumented immigrants since 2009,” the editorial, posted January 11, said:
“Some 27.6 percent of the Omaha area’s Hispanic residents now live in poverty conditions, up from 16.9 percent in 2000, The World-Herald’s Henry Cordes reported last week. The national Hispanic poverty rate is 25.3 percent.
“This trend results in an array of negative consequences: misery and frustration for households, challenges for schools and medical providers; stresses on neighborhoods; roadblocks to economic progress for South Omaha itself and for Nebraska’s largest city, too,” the editorial said.
It quoted a local school official that “these trend lines” don’t “bode well for our community, our workforce, or everyone’s economic well-being.”
